/**
* @brief Reads a FEP plus file and adds found features to the feature set.
* In case of an error an exception is thrown. Only closed polygons
* are supported.
*
* Example:
* 13.0 52.0
* 13.0 53.0
* 14.0 53.0
* 14.0 52.0
* 99.0 99.0 4
* L Germany
*
* Format definition:
* longtitude1 latitude1
* ...
* longtitudeN latitudeN
* 99.0 99.0 VERTEX_COUNT
* L POLYGON_NAME
*
* A polygon starts with a number vertex lines. A vetex contains 2 floats,
* longitude and latitude, and may be followed by a comment which must not
* start on a digit.
*
* A polygon is required to declare at least 3 vertices. If the last vertex
* matches the first one a minimum of 4 vertices are required.
*
* After the vertex definition an option vertex count line may follow
* expressed with a longitude and latitude value of 99 followed by the
* vertex count. If the count does not match the vertices read a warning
* is reported.
*
* A polygon is finalized by an mandatory L line defining the polygon name.
*
* All lines read are stipped first. Empty lines and lines starting on '#'
* are ignored.
*
* @param featureSet The target feature that will hold the read features
* @param filename The path to the GeoJSON file
* @param category An optional category attached to all read features
* @return The number of features read
*/
size_t readFEP(GeoFeatureSet &featureSet, const std::string &path,
const Category *category = nullptr);
